fix old & nasty squared thumb resizing bug

This commit is contained in:
Ian 2014-09-20 20:11:09 +02:00
parent 88f10654f0
commit a70de2f12c
2 changed files with 8 additions and 3 deletions

View file

@ -2,6 +2,9 @@
-----
* Added description for max-width and max-height option setting
* Fix old bug with image resize thumb creation on both max-options = n
Part 2 of this bug was introduced in S9y 2.0 development for ImageMagick
escapeshellcmd method.
0.43/44:

View file

@ -212,8 +212,7 @@ class serendipity_event_imageselectorplus extends serendipity_event
}
$newsizes = array('width' => $_newsizes[0], 'height' => $_newsizes[1]);
} else {
$newsizes = $sizes;
array(
$newsizes = array(
0 => $sizes['width'],
1 => $sizes['height']
);
@ -227,7 +226,10 @@ class serendipity_event_imageselectorplus extends serendipity_event
} elseif ($sizes['height'] == 0) {
$_newsizes = serendipity_calculate_aspect_size($fdim[0], $fdim[1], $sizes['width'], 'width');
} else {
$_newsizes = $sizes;
$_newsizes = array(
0 => $sizes['width'],
1 => $sizes['height']
);
}
$newsizes = array('width' => $_newsizes[0], 'height' => $_newsizes[1]);
}